A new tool named Resident has been announced, offering a code sandbox with hot reload capabilities specifically designed for ESP32 devices. This framework allows developers to run user-defined Lua scripts while interacting with hardware components via approved drivers. The integration of websockets with the Claude skill enables real-time app pushing and iteration, allowing end users to easily swap and load applications—empowering IoT devices with enhanced functionality and interactivity.
The significance of Resident lies in its ability to bridge AI agents with physical devices, making it easier for developers to create customizable and responsive applications. Built on existing platforms like Arduino and esp-idf, it provides a straightforward setup for networking and hardware interaction. The sandbox supports rapid app development and deployment through features like hot-reloading of Lua applications and seamless communication via JSON over websockets.
